主机VPS软件有哪些?如何选择适合自己的VPS软件?
| 软件名称 |
适用场景 |
核心功能 |
学习成本 |
价格区间 |
| VirtualBox |
个人开发/测试 |
虚拟化、快照、多系统支持 |
低 |
免费 |
| VMware Workstation |
企业级应用 |
高级网络配置、资源隔离 |
中高 |
付费订阅 |
| Proxmox VE |
服务器虚拟化 |
基于KVM/LXC、集群管理 |
中 |
开源免费 |
| OpenVZ |
高密度部署 |
轻量级容器、资源高效利用 |
中 |
商业授权 |
主机VPS软件选择与使用指南
一、主流VPS软件对比分析
根据应用场景和技术需求,以下是四类典型VPS软件的详细对比:
- VirtualBox
- 操作说明:Oracle开发的跨平台虚拟化工具,支持Windows/macOS/Linux系统
- 使用提示:适合搭建开发测试环境,可通过
VBoxManage命令行工具进行高级配置
VBoxManage createvm --name "TestVM" --register
- VMware Workstation
- 操作说明:提供企业级虚拟化解决方案,支持3D图形和USB设备直通
- 使用提示:建议配置至少8GB内存,启用硬件虚拟化加速可提升性能30%以上
- Proxmox VE
- 操作说明:基于Debian的服务器虚拟化平台,支持KVM和LXC双模式
- 使用提示:可通过Web界面管理,集群部署需配置共享存储
- OpenVZ
- 操作说明:采用操作系统级虚拟化技术,资源占用率低于传统虚拟化
- 使用提示:适合运行同构应用,容器间隔离性较弱
二、常见问题解决方案
| 问题现象 |
可能原因 |
解决方法 |
| 虚拟机启动失败 |
虚拟化未在BIOS中启用 |
进入BIOS开启Intel VT/AMD-V |
| 网络连接不稳定 |
虚拟网卡驱动不兼容 |
更新VMware Tools/VBox Guest Additions |
| 磁盘空间不足 |
快照文件累积占用 |
使用VBoxManage clonsnap清理快照 |
| 性能低于预期 |
资源分配不合理 |
调整CPU核心数和内存分配比例 |
三、操作流程建议
- 需求评估阶段
- 明确用途:开发测试/生产环境/教学演示
- 评估硬件:CPU虚拟化支持、内存容量、存储类型
- 软件安装步骤
- 优化配置技巧
- 启用半虚拟化驱动
- 设置资源限制阈值
- 配置定期自动备份
对于初次接触VPS软件的用户,建议从VirtualBox开始入门,其图形化界面和丰富的文档资源能显著降低学习曲线。企业用户则更推荐采用Proxmox VE或VMware方案,以获得更好的稳定性和管理功能。
发表评论